This property is in the heart of downtown Huntington Beach real estate, just off of Main Street. The front of the house has a small fenced and grassy yard. Since many homes in this area lack outdoor space, this small area gives you a bit of outdoor space and doesn’t require much upkeep.
This yard is one of two outdoor areas that this house offers.
Upon entering, the living room is directly to your right, and the first set of stairs is almost immediately in front of you.
As a whole this house has a moderate amount of upgrades. The house is move in ready, but will probably need some updates down the line.
The kitchen is a decent size, and has stainless steel appliances. However, the white tiles will eventually need to be replaced with something a bit more comparable to granite.
And while the front living room and plantation shutters are nice, the shape of it is a bit awkwardly shaped for furniture.
On the other side of the kitchen, towards the back of the house there is additional space for a large dining room table. Next to this space is a second set of stairs, and French doors that open up out onto the concrete patio.
The light pouring into this house is incredible.
Just up the stairs, on the second floor is a spacious bedroom.
Beautiful hardwood floor cover the hallways of the second floor.
Straight ahead is another bedroom. This one is a bit on the smaller side, but it does have two closets and an attached bathroom.
The closet doors need a bit of an upgrade.
The bathroom has the same white tile as the kitchen, which will need to be replaced and upgraded at some point. However, it is clean and appears to be new.
Down the hallway, towards the front of the house is the laundry room, and then a small office.
Back towards the front of the house is the master bedroom. Although the bedroom has a lot of natural light, the overall size is a bit disappointing. However, the fireplace is a nice plus.
The windows in the master bedroom and throughout the house also need an upgrade.
The flooring in the master bedroom is carpet. However, once you get into the bathroom, part of it is hardwood and the other portion is tile.
The shower needs a bit of an upgrade, but this bathroom is very light and airy.
The closet is a moderate size, but at least it has built-ins.
Back up the stairs, on the third level is a nice surprise.
There is a nice sized bonus room with hardwood floors, a wet bar, and a bathroom.
There is also a small balcony that looks over onto the concrete courtyard below.
Back towards the stairs, at the end of the hallway is a door that leads out on to a large deck.
This home is ideal for a small family. The multi levels make it slightly less ideal for families with small children, but top level could be ideal for a playroom. All of the bedrooms are on the same level, and the washer and dryer hookups being on the same level as the bedrooms is incredibly convenient for someone with a small family.
